What Is Civil Trespassing Law?

Trespass can be a criminal or civil violation. If someone intentionally enters your property without permission, they are liable for any damage. Damages in a civil trespass claim include loss of property value, costs to repair the damage, and lost use of the property.

What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Personal Injury Lawyer To Sue for Trespassing?

You need to prove the elements of civil trespass to recover compensation. You should talk to a personal injury lawyer about a civil trespassing lawsuit if someone:

  • Is continually trespassing on your property despite you asking them to leave
  • Someone destroyed your property after trespassing on it, including a fence, garden, or building
  • Someone was invading your privacy, including peeking into your windows
  • Someone is affecting your ability to make money from your commercial property

What Could Happen if I Don’t Hire a Personal Injury Lawyer?

If you don’t hire a personal injury lawyer, you might struggle to get fair compensation for your injuries. Without legal guidance, you could miss important deadlines to file a lawsuit, fail to gather the right evidence, or be taken advantage of by insurance companies. This might result in accepting a settlement offer that is less than what you need to cover medical bills, lost wages, and other expenses. A lawyer helps protect your rights, builds a strong case, and negotiates on your behalf, increasing your chances of getting the most possible compensation.
